I live in the area the show was done and have seen at least a few of the cars that were "Overhauled" in person at local car shows or cruise ins. Other than showing a little road ware I was surprised at the level of craftsmanship and detail that went into these cars. No bondo pop, paint shrinkage or sanding marks showing through which all would be typical of cars done in rush. One of the first cars they did belonged to a guy that works at the same place as my son and My boy says the car is still looking very good. Regardless of the kind of cars they do I still have great respect for the skill and talent that it takes to get it done.
